This volume explores the complex interplay between national and transnational memory narratives in Central Europe. Following the European integration after 1989, a shift towards transnational remembrance seemed possible, aiming to foster a new European identity. However, national memory traditions have demonstrated resilience, simultaneously forging new relationships with Europe where the national perspective often gains renewed prominence.

Through detailed analyses of fictional and non-fictional texts, as well as representations in television, film, photography, and museum exhibitions, the book investigates this simultaneous persistence and evolution of memory cultures. It seeks to understand the resurgence of national interpretive patterns in contemporary Europe by examining shared remembrance, ultimately addressing the opportunities and challenges present in today's evolving European memory landscapes.
